Viticulture
Fruit is sourced from neighboring properties in the most northern sub-region of Margaret River. Direct input from Forester`s viticulturist ensures well balanced canopies and crops are grown for the desired fresh fruit driven style. The 2025 vintage was a mild year for white grapes in Margaret River, allowing plenty of time during January and February to ripen the fruit to our specification. Grapes were harvested at a lower baume to achieve the delicate style.
Winemaking
Modern white wine making techniques are employed in the production of the Brut Cuvee, with temperature control considered critical from the moment the fruit reaches the winery. The fruit is destemmed and crushed, then must chilled and pressed off skins in a very short space of time. A long cool fermentation follows, allowing for the retention of the delicate fruit characters in the base wine.
